jaylemurph Posted July 16, 2013 #12 Share Posted July 16, 2013 Cayce was never jailed. Are you confusing him with Joseph Smith, founder of the Mormon Church? Cayce was, in fact, arrested in 1935 for practicing medicine without a license and (briefly) put in jail for it. He was also arrested for fortune-telling in New York state in 1932. And I am not confusing him with (as Kmt points out) the other noted charlatan and fabricator of fictional langauges and history, Joe Smith. And while this information is readily available through normal media, it is not (oddly) available through the network of people continuing his practice of bilking others. Harte Posted July 16, 2013 #14 Share Posted July 16, 2013 Ground penetrating radar has proven there is a chamber or something under the Sphinx. What is in it if anything will remain a mystery until the Egyptian government lets someone dig and I don't look for that to happen. It'as been dug (or drilled) into twice. It's a natural cavity - a crack in the limestone bedrock. Harte 3 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
